Ticket: Staging env misconfigured for Siftgate bloom filter

The bloom layer in front of the Pellet KV store is rejecting all lookups in staging because the env file was copied from the dev template without credentials. False-positive tuning values are fine; only the auth line is missing. To unblock the weekly demo, the Pellet admission secret must be set on the following line.

env line for yaguf-fajop: LEDGER_TOKEN13=fb08984397349

Subject: DR drill Thursday — cutoff rule service

On-call: Thursday 06:00 we simulate full loss of the Ovenrise order-cutoff service. The rule (no cake orders after 14:00 for next-day pickup at any Millbrant Bakehouse location) must keep enforcing during failover or the kitchens get flooded. Steps: kill primary, promote the Ashgrove replica, confirm cutoff checks fire, re-point the storefront. Replica config is sealed; you will need to unlock it during the drill. Unlock passphrase is below.

unlock words, kajef-kadug: sorys-pelax-lamael-tamvan-briiel-novdor-fenwyn-tamdor-oliion-keleth-julok-belion-ralok

TURN-208: Gatevale turnstile counters at the Merrow Field pilot double-count when a rotation reverses mid-cycle. Attendance totals drift roughly 2% high per event. The debounce window fix is implemented, reviewed by Ilsa, and soak-tested across two simulated match days without drift. Ready for your cut; the candidate build is identified below.

trace token, tagag-tafog: htk6_5ed18c

Ticket VELD-2281: Zero-downtime migration for the ledger table on Orchardline. The expand phase shipped last sprint; this ticket covers the contract phase. Dual-writes have been verified for 72 hours with no drift. Request: schedule the column drop during the low-traffic window, with rollback script staged on the migration host. No customer-facing impact expected. For audit purposes, the deployment must reference the trace token recorded below.

pipeline stamp: htk31_f769b577b3028a4e9958e5bb8d1259a